23:17:10 dansmith moving the ironic node id to be the provider id is the right move (which we've already done)
23:17:32 dansmith so I dunno, maybe that means for <rocky, the name hack works, but... it's kinda contrary to the point of the provider id
23:17:45 melwitt what's the right move in the non-ironic case then?
23:17:45 dansmith melwitt: I think I hinted at this in my email on the internal thread about this
23:18:01 dansmith for the service delete?
23:18:08 dansmith that's probably even worse really,
23:18:17 melwitt I assume it's service delete. I don't know for sure how they got into that state
23:18:34 dansmith because if you end up with two computes with the same name due to some dns or dhcp breakage, they'll take over each others' providers (and allocations) which would be helzabad
23:18:37 melwitt that thread spun off from the ironic bz
23:19:22 dansmith you will have other issues if you have a name clash, obviously, but if you mix allocations from two computes together, or have one go negative because it's a smaller compute, just... hard to debug and fix
23:19:45 dansmith so anyway, I dunno
23:20:01 dansmith not saying don't do it.. glad we don't have to do it on master, but I'm not super confident that it's a great idea for <rocky either
23:20:02 melwitt ok... sigh.. so with the moving node id to be provider id, would that not require a migration step if we were able to backport to queens?
23:20:17 dansmith that only affects ironic
23:20:50 melwitt yeah sorry. going back to the ironic thing again, to fix that one in that way, would it require a migration step?
23:21:26 dansmith as I said on that thread, you'd have to make sure all the computes rolled to that change atomically, and yeah I dunno how the allocations get or got moved with that when we transitioned,
23:21:35 dansmith but not reasonable for a backport either way
23:21:49 melwitt I can and will publish the workaround steps but given the number of customers hitting it, I dunno, thinking about trying the backport
23:21:52 dansmith reversing the order of provider delete works around the ironic issue doesn't it?
23:22:01 melwitt yeah it does
23:22:25 dansmith that's reasonable, backporting the node uuid thing is not reasonable I think
23:22:38 melwitt ok. got it
23:22:55 melwitt thanks
23:24:15 melwitt the non-ironic thing I think need more information because I don't know how it got into the state. and no idea how to workaround bc they can't migrate any instances away from it because all migrations fail with ResourceProviderCreationFailed
23:24:48 melwitt and there's no heal_allocations so they can't delete the allocations and RP and restore allocations
23:24:58 dansmith well, they can
23:25:02 dansmith using osc-placement
23:25:14 dansmith I mean, you can script that for them
23:25:24 dansmith or backport heal allocations, that's much less scary I think
23:25:43 melwitt yeah, that's what I'm thinking
23:25:47 dansmith heal allocations will just fix it so you can delete everything, let it create and then heal right?
23:25:51 melwitt osc-placement I didn't see a way to update a RP with a different uuid
23:25:56 dansmith you mean the nova-manage healer thing right?
23:26:02 melwitt I do yeah
23:26:26 dansmith i.e. the sunday morning public access TV version of nova.. BAH HALED!
23:26:49 melwitt lol
23:26:58 dansmith melwitt: I mean with osc-placement you can create and delete allocations, IIRC, so you can save them off, then re-add them after it creates the provider afresh
